NESNELERİN İNTERNETİ İÇİN HİBRİT UYGULAMA KATMANI PROTOKOL TASARIMI

Nesnelerin İnternetinde, iletişim başarımını etkileyen önemli faktörlerden biri kullanılacak olan mesajlaşma protokolüdür. MQTT, XMPP ve AMQP merkezi yapıda ve sunucu aracılığıyla haberleşen uygulama protokolleridir. DDS ve CoAP ise özellikle gerçek zamanlı uygulamalarda doğrudan iletişim için kulla...

Full description

Saved in:
Bibliographic Details
Published inMühendislik Bilimleri ve Tasarım Dergisi Vol. 8; no. 1; pp. 285 - 304
Main Authors ÖZDOĞAN, Erdal, ERDEM, O. Ayhan
Format Journal Article
LanguageEnglish
Published 20.03.2020
Online AccessGet full text

Cover

Loading…
More Information
Summary:Nesnelerin İnternetinde, iletişim başarımını etkileyen önemli faktörlerden biri kullanılacak olan mesajlaşma protokolüdür. MQTT, XMPP ve AMQP merkezi yapıda ve sunucu aracılığıyla haberleşen uygulama protokolleridir. DDS ve CoAP ise özellikle gerçek zamanlı uygulamalarda doğrudan iletişim için kullanılan uygulama protokolleridir. Nesnelerin İnternetinin giderek yaygınlaşması ve kullanım senaryolarının farklı gereksinimlere sahip olması, veri iletişiminde yeni yaklaşımların geliştirilmesini gerekli kılmaktadır. Bu çalışmada hem merkezi sunucu aracılığıyla hem de doğrudan iletişim sağlayabilen UDP tabanlı hibrit bir protokol tasarlanmıştır. Geliştirilen protokolün çalışma mantığı, paket yapısı ele alınmış ve işlevsellik yönünden MQTT protokolü ile karşılaştırılmıştır. One of the important factors affecting communication performance in the Internet of Things is the messaging protocol. MQTT, XMPP and AMQP are centralized application protocols that communicate through the server. DDS and CoAP are application protocols that can communicate directly, especially in real-time applications. As the Internet of Things is becoming more widespread and usage scenarios have different requirements, new approaches to data communication are required. In this study a UDP based hybrid protocol is designed which can communicate both directly and through central server. Operating logic and packet structure of the developed protocol is examined and compared with MQTT protocol with respect to their functionality. 
ISSN:1308-6693
1308-6693
DOI:10.21923/jesd.530295